If you are running a 1Gbps, 2.5Gbps, or 10Gbps local network or fiber internet connection, standard 100MB or 1GB test files download too quickly to measure accurately. A 10GB file takes roughly 80 seconds on a gigabit line and over 13 minutes on a 100Mbps line, providing ample data points for analysis. Standard, browser-based speed tests are designed for quick consumer check-ups. They download small chunks of data for a few seconds to estimate your bandwidth. This methodology introduces several limitations for enterprise environments:
Brief tests do not allow hardware components to reach their maximum operating temperatures or sustained throughput limits.
